React Developer [Job ID: 177185]
Tech Wave Solutions, Lahore, Pakistan - Office Based
Address: Etihad Town Lahore
Job Type
Full Time
Job Shift
Flexible Hours
Experience
2 Years
Degree
Bachelor's
Positions
1
Salary
PKR 100 Monthly
Category
Software Development (Mobile and Web Development)
Degree Names
Bachelor's in Computer Science
Description
Job Description
We are looking for a passionate and detail-oriented React Developer with 1–2 years of professional experience to join our growing development team. The ideal candidate should have a strong understanding of front-end technologies, React.js ecosystem, and be able to translate business requirements into clean, efficient, and reusable code.
You will work closely with backend developers, UI/UX designers, and other team members to build high-quality web applications that deliver an excellent user experience.
Responsibilities
- Develop new user-facing features using React.js.
- Build reusable components and front-end libraries for future use.
- Optimize applications for maximum speed and scalability.
- Collaborate with designers to ensure UI/UX designs are implemented correctly.
- Integrate with backend APIs (REST/GraphQL).
- Troubleshoot, debug, and upgrade existing applications.
- Stay updated with the latest front-end technologies and industry best practices.
Required Skills
- 1–2 years of hands-on experience in React.js.
- Proficiency in JavaScript (ES6+), HTML5, CSS3.
- Strong knowledge of React hooks, state management (Context API / Redux).
- Familiarity with RESTful APIs and asynchronous request handling.
- Experience with Git / version control.
- Understanding of responsive design & cross-browser compatibility.
- Basic knowledge of unit testing (Jest, React Testing Library).
- Good problem-solving and debugging skills.
- Strong communication and collaboration abilities.
Nice-to-Have (Optional)
- Knowledge of TypeScript.
- Experience with Next.js or other React frameworks.
- Understanding of CI/CD pipelines.
- Exposure to Agile / Scrum methodologies.
